While many people choose not to invest in nondestructive testing (NDT) equipment, it might actually be a smart move in the long run. If one wants to get a hold of this kind of equipment there is an option to either purchase or rent. It’s important to note that there certainly are NDT inspection equipment for rent.

Depending on the situation, renting can be a better option over purchasing. Rental equipment can even be shipped out within the same day from companies that have a large supply of NDT rental equipment. This wouldn’t be the case if the equipment were to be bought due to the fact that both processes are carried out differently.

 Purchasing the equipment requires management approval while renting involves a cost with little to no approval. Besides the reasonable cost and time commitment that comes with renting equipment, NDT equipment rentals come already calibrated to a well known standard according to the manufacturer. This is very helpful for those who do not have much expertise with NDT equipment and need to have the setting of the equipment already in place for use.

Some key points to make about renting NDT equipment is that it often makes sense to rent the equipment when one plans to buy it in the future. It can be an affordable option for companies to test out the equipment they need before making a big purchase.

 For example, if a company is on the edge about buying a thermal imager or an XRF analyzer they might choose to rent them out for a small project before they make that commitment. Making the decision to rent out the equipment may be a cost-friendly option for companies to use in order to make the best decision possible.

When looking for a modular home there are some things that people should be aware of so they get what they want in a home. There are many modular home dealers in Michigan that can be used to help a person find their modular home. There are some tips and a guide to selecting the best modular home based on specific needs.

Process

Like purchasing any other home there is a process for working with a modular home dealer Michigan. A person will need to get pre approved so they can develop a budget for the rest of the process. This includes building expenses.

After a person has their budget in mind they can go about preparing the lot. A person will need to get the required land tests done and they will need to have their site inspected. If they do not already have a lot picked out a builder can help them find a great lot.

Once the location has been picked out it is time to begin to design the home. A person can work with the engineering department to design all of the features that they are looking for and will be able to get their modular home customized. Once they are given the final plans the building will begin.

Once the financing is in place and everything is set up the building of the modular home can begin. It will take anywhere between 30 to 120 days for the process to be completed. The majority of the construction is off-site and then the home is shipped to its location. By the time it gets to its destination the home will be anywhere from 70 to 90 percent complete. While the home is building the log will also be worked on. It will be cleared out and a septic system and foundation will be installed.

Selecting the Manufacturer

This is a major purchase so it is important to find the right manufacturer to build the home. There are differences in modular companies so before hiring one to build the home find the one that will build it correctly. Some can make several thousand homes a year while others may build around a dozen. If there is a specialty design it may be better to go with the smaller companies but it will take more time for the project to be completed. Some homes will limit their availability based on location. Some will be able to be restricted to a specific area while others will be able to deliver the home within a 500-mile radius. Most builders will follow a specific design.

Energy Efficient

Modular homes can be designed to be energy efficient. This will allow resources to be conserved and will allow a person to reduce their carbon footprint. There is a specific material that can be used in the construction of these homes to reduce the impact that they have on the environment. A person should speak to their builder if they are interested in these options.

Customization

While a manufacturer may have stock options available most of the modular homes can be upgraded. A person can get their needs met with their home and in most cases, all they need to do is speak up.

These are some things to look for when looking for a modular home. They can customize the home to their liking and have their home shipped to the exact location that they have picked out and are waiting for this home.

 

Over the ages, it can be proven that cellphones are emitting more radiation compared to their predecessors. At the moment, the radiation standards for your phone go way back into the ’90s. In actuality, this is not a bad thing if you still use your belt clip that is. A lot of these new smartphones manuals on the market talk about using accessories that will keep your handset at the very least, 1cm away from your body. But how many people read manuals anyway?

 

However, the cellphone industry has come under legal heat since the government passed a law that mandates them to inform their clients on the radiation risk.

 

The manufacturer has to conduct two assessments to quantize how much RF energy a test dummy will absorb from each phone. One experiment mimics talking on the phone with the device right up the dummy’s head. The other simulation aims to show just how much radiation a body would get only from carrying the equipment.

 

The manufactures are still bent on producing devices that are scratch-resistant and are getting slimmer by the month. Most phone producers assume the customer will carry their phones in their purses or backpacks. In this time and age, that is the most extraordinary thing. There is no mention of anti-radiation phone cases in their manuals. According to them, any case is a good case as long as it does not have metal on it.

 

As a daily phone user, you need to protect yourself from RF energy. The easiest way you can do this is to get an anti-radiation phone case. These phone cases are in design to limit exposure. However, you should be careful when picking out an anti-radiation phone case since some will tend to do more harm than good; that is, depending on the material that is in use and the engineering process of the product.

 

As a customer, it would be wise to understand that regardless of all these efforts, you cannot modify the radiations emitted by your device. The only thing you can do is to reduce its intensity. This factor is crucial because, even if you could modify the emitted signals, your cellphone would lose its ability to connect to a network and communicate, thereby losing its one intended function

 

When you are out looking for an anti radiation phone case, there are a few things you should look into to ensure effectiveness. For starters, settle for a phone case that does not cover the antenna. Thick rugged cases will shield your phone against scratches and outdoor elements, but they will probably create a shield around the antenna. 

 

This blockage will result in the cellphone working harder to find a signal, thus emitting more substantial RF energy. A sure sign that your phone case is blocking the antenna is if your phone is excessively draining the battery even after regular usage.

 

Also, it would not be advisable to go for a phone case with a metallic piece in it, whether it was just for elegance or with a practical reason. Metal is a natural conductor that will amplify RF signals.
